DVDs Vol.7 and 8

Just a little note: DVD Volume 7 and 8 are scheduled to be released on March 23rd.
No box pictures yet either, but it looks like Volume 7 will cover the three "Return to New York" episodes and Volume 8 will cover the "Search for Splinter" episodes.

Can't remember where I heard it, but Vol. 7, titled "Return to New York", will feature "The Mouse Hunters" and the 3 "Return to New York" eps (yes, another 4 episode volume!!!). Vol. 8, "Search For Splinter" will be back to 3 eps per disc with "Lone Raph and Lone Cub" and the "Search For Splinter" 2-parter.
